Baltimore County Police Alert Parents About Teen Gatherings

Authorities in Baltimore County are cautioning parents about potential risks associated with unsupervised teen meetups.

Updated

Baltimore County Police have issued a warning to parents regarding the rise of unsupervised gatherings among teenagers in the area. Police officials are concerned about the potential dangers these meetups may pose to youth safety.

In recent weeks, law enforcement has observed an increase in reports related to these gatherings, which can lead to unsafe situations. Authorities are urging parents to remain vigilant and to engage in conversations with their children about the importance of safety and responsible behavior.

Police suggest that parents monitor their teens' activities and whereabouts, particularly during weekends and evenings when these meetups are more likely to occur. They emphasize the need for open communication to ensure that young people are making safe choices.
